Stand Up Paddling in Ljubljana offers a unique perspective on Slovenia’s vibrant capital, blending urban energy with the tranquillity of nature. The Ljubljanica River, winding through the heart of the city, provides an inviting setting for paddleboarding, where medieval bridges, Baroque facades and lively riverside cafés create a dynamic backdrop. As you glide beneath the iconic Dragon Bridge and past the leafy banks of Tivoli Park, the city’s relaxed rhythm and green spirit become palpable. Ljubljana’s compact size and pedestrian-friendly centre make it easy to access the water, while the surrounding hills and distant peaks of the Julian Alps frame the experience with a sense of adventure and discovery.
Paddleboarding in Ljubljana is both serene and stimulating. The typical route follows the gentle curves of the Ljubljanica, starting near Špica Park and meandering towards the old town, with sessions usually lasting between one and two hours. The water is calm and clear, reflecting the pastel colours of riverside buildings and the shifting light of the Slovenian sky. Early mornings bring a soft mist and the quiet sounds of awakening city life, while afternoons are filled with the laughter of locals and the scent of blooming linden trees. The experience is accessible yet engaging, with opportunities to pause beneath weeping willows, observe herons on the banks, or simply enjoy the cool sensation of water beneath your feet. For those seeking a livelier pace, some guides offer sessions that include gentle currents or basic SUP yoga, adding variety to the journey.
Local guides in Ljubljana are passionate about outdoor sports and deeply familiar with the river’s moods and nuances. All instructors are certified and provide high-quality paddleboards, adjustable paddles, buoyancy aids and, when needed, wetsuits or windbreakers to match the season. Safety is a priority, with clear briefings on technique, river etiquette and local conditions. The city’s outdoor culture is welcoming and inclusive, reflecting Slovenia’s broader commitment to nature and sustainability. Meeting points are conveniently located near the city centre, with easy access by foot, bicycle or public transport, making logistics straightforward for visitors.
The best time for stand up paddleboarding in Ljubljana is from late spring to early autumn, when temperatures are mild and the river is at its most inviting. Beginners are welcome, as the calm waters and expert instruction make it easy to learn the basics, though a reasonable level of fitness and balance is recommended for comfort and enjoyment. More experienced paddlers can refine their technique or explore longer routes towards Trnovo or Livada. Paddleboarding here suits solo travellers, couples, families with older children and groups of friends seeking a fresh way to experience the city.
